The Edelweißhütte am Schneeberg is a welcoming mountain hut, restaurant, and accommodation nestled on the northern side of the Schneeberg massif, Austria's highest mountain in Lower Austria. Situated on the Fadensattel at an elevation of 1,235 meters, within the Rax-Schneeberg Group of the Wiener Alpen, it offers a perfect base for exploring this stunning region. Managed by the Edelweiss section of the Austrian Alpine Club (ÖAV), the hut is a popular destination for hikers and nature lovers alike.

    Frequently Asked Questions

    What are the easiest ways to reach Edelweißhütte am Schneeberg for beginners or families?

    For a comfortable ascent, you can take the Schneeberg chairlift (Salamander-Sessellift) from Losenheim, which drops you near the hut. Alternatively, a relatively easy hike from Losenheim takes about an hour, or approximately 30 minutes from the valley station of the Puchberg-Sesselbahn via a direct route. These options are ideal for families and those new to mountain hiking.

    What are the parking options and public transport connections to Edelweißhütte am Schneeberg?

    Parking is available at the valley station in Losenheim. For public transport, you can take a train to Puchberg am Schneeberg, and then connect to Losenheim via local bus services or a short taxi ride. It's advisable to check schedules in advance, especially outside peak season.

    Is Edelweißhütte am Schneeberg suitable for winter hiking, and what should I consider?

    Yes, the Edelweißhütte operates year-round, making it suitable for winter visits. However, winter hiking on Schneeberg requires appropriate gear, including sturdy winter boots, warm clothing, and potentially snowshoes or microspikes depending on snow conditions. Always check the weather forecast and trail conditions before heading out in winter.

    Are there any nearby amenities or accommodation options besides the hut itself?

    The Edelweißhütte offers comfortable overnight accommodation with 12 beds and 20 mattress places. In the nearby village of Puchberg am Schneeberg, you'll find additional guesthouses, hotels, and restaurants if you prefer to stay off the mountain or need more extensive amenities.

    What are the typical opening hours and rest days for the Edelweißhütte?

    The Edelweißhütte generally operates year-round, typically closing only in November and for short periods in January. Outside of holiday seasons, Tuesdays and Wednesdays are often rest days. It's highly recommended to check their official website or call ahead for the most current opening hours and any planned closures before your visit.
